  • Publication number: 20020187020
    Abstract: A lock washer for locking a threaded fastener from loosening under vibration includes an annular body with a central opening cutting from a sheet or plate of Nitinol, and an integral layer of NiTiOx on at least one face of said body. The lock washer is made of a high transition temperature form of Type 55 Nitinol that remains in its martensitic state in all normal conditions of use. The martensitic Nitinol initially yields during torquing of the nut to allow the nut to indent itself slightly into the lock washer. The resulting cold working of the washer material causes a transformation into stress-induced martensite, which is strong and elastic to resist further deformation and also exerts a preload on the bolt shank. The nut, indented into the lock washer, strongly resists turning under vibration, which effect is further enhanced by the vibration absorbing characteristics of the material. The integral layer of NiTiOx on the surface of the washer provides electrical insulation, minimizing galvanic corrosion.

  • Patent number: 6152665
    Abstract: A direct tension indicating washer including a body having an internal opening formed therein and at least one arched tab connected to the body. The arched tab has a fixed end integral with the body and a distal end movable with respect to the body. Indicia is formed on the arched tab and when the direct tension indicating washer is tensioned, the arched tab moves away from the body. Alignment of the indicia with a reference indicates proper tension. Another embodiment of the invention is a direct tension indicating washer having a body having an internal opening formed therein and at least one arch connected to the body. The arch has a first end integral with the body, a second end integral with the body and an intermediate portion between the first end and second end. The intermediate portion is positioned above a top surface of the body.

  • Patent number: 6039408
    Abstract: A break-away lug nut positioner for holding lug nuts on a race car wheel to facilitate more rapid tire changes during pit stops. The break-away lug nut positioner includes a spacer that supports a lug nut at a proper distance over a mounting hole of a race car wheel. That is, the spacer holds the lug nut so that it is adjacent to a threaded mounting stud when the wheel is held flush against the race car hub. During installation, the lug nut is driven into the spacer cavity, forcing the spacer to break into pieces. The adhesive bond between the lug nut and the spacer is weaker than the individual pieces of the spacer, which causes the spacer to separate cleanly from the lug nut, allowing the lug nut to seat properly against the wheel mounting plate. That is, the adhesive and the material and configuration of the spacer are selected so that the spacer breaks cleanly away from the lug nut, and no spacer material remains between the lug nut and the mounting plate.

  • Patent number: 5829933
    Abstract: A Belleville spring washer (15) having an annular relief (25) depending from in its top surface (24). The relief (25) is disposed adjacent the circumferential wall (27) forming a centrally disposed opening (18) for the washer (15), the circumferential wall (27) not physically engaging the shank (37) of a fastener (39) when mounted and torqued thereon. The washer (15) includes a series of radially-extending serrations (23), each beginning adjacent the relief (25) and extending outwardly through the span (21) of the annular body (17) forming washer (15). In its mounting to a fastener (39) to be applied to a bearing surface (45), the serrations (23) face the undersurface (40) of the fastener's head (42), and the head (42) is torqued to a proper setting. The serrations (23) efficaciously bite into the head's undersurface (40), providing a tight engagement of fastener (39) to the bearing surface (45), and one which eliminates looseness in the fastener (39) upon a thermal expansion of the metal of the elements.

  • Patent number: 5687453
    Abstract: Radio noise in an automotive vehicle is suppressed by grounding the hood of the automotive vehicle with a conductive washer. The conductive washer is concave and is disposed around a rivet used to pivot a hood hinge component to a body hinge component. When the rivet is set, the hinge components compress the washer so as to permanently load the washer to thereby ensure continuous grounding of the hood to the body. Preferably, the rivet is coated with a dry lubricant, such as TEFLON.RTM., which does not flow away from the rivet to interfere with electrical contact between the washer and hinge components.
